About HF

People. Not just lawyers

Hempsons are part of the HF group of companies and are leading legal experts in the sectors of health and social care, charities, clinical negligence and professional support and advice for medical practitioners. They support the NHS and other organisations across the public, private and third sectors, delivering expert legal advice drawn from deep sector knowledge and experience.

We are looking to recruit an experienced healthcare litigation lawyer, who will undertake a wide variety of healthcare litigation work for the NHS and other public and private healthcare providers. There may also be an opportunity to undertake client secondments.

This role will provide you with the opportunity to join one of the country's leading healthcare law firms
